Cyanotypes
We first chose a picture we have taken before with contrasts in color and has negative spaces. I chose building with different angles and shapes from New York. After resizing the image, I went into Photoshop to make the entire photo inverted. Then I printed out on see-through special paper. We used transparent glass (plexi glass) to cover the color and then we clipped it all together. We went outside for sunset. After that, we put the photo that was now blue into water (we also put in lemon and vinegar). Then we dried it. My original is the top picture of this page.
